What this data tells you about Dr. Hudanich

Dr. Ronald Hudanich is an orthopedic surgery in Oviedo, FL, with 19 years in practice. Based on federal Medicare data, Dr. Hudanich performed 3,020 Medicare services across 1,968 unique beneficiaries.

Between the years covered by Open Payments, Dr. Hudanich received a total of $98,973 from 16 pharmaceutical and/or device companies across 333 individual payments. These payments are legal, publicly disclosed under the federal Sunshine Act, and common in orthopedic surgery. The majority of payments are for consulting, which typically reflects recognized clinical expertise sought by manufacturers. Patients may wish to discuss these relationships with their provider.

Is this data up to date?
Each data source has its own update cycle. Provider registry data (NPPES) is updated weekly. Medicare enrollment (PECOS) is updated monthly. Medicare practice data has a ~2 year lag — the most recent available is typically 2 years prior. Industry payment data (Open Payments) is published annually, usually in June, covering the prior calendar year.
